Spuria Popularity Poll 2013

The Spuria Iris Society conducted a poll of its members in 2013 to pick their favorite introductions. The top cultivars are listed in a table below the photos of the most popular. Their website has the 2012 and 2013 results here. See also the 2012 and 2014 favorites' photos.

2013 VotesCultivar NameHybridizer, Year
31 Zulu Chief Jenkins, 1992
18 Stella Irene Jenkins, 1995
17 Cinnamon Stick Niswonger, 1983
16 Purple Concerto Jenkins, 1993
15 Rodeo Blue Jenkins, 1994
14 Bay of Silk Blyth, 2003/04
14 Innovator Hager, 1991
13 Ross Island Price, 2012
12 Golden Ducat Cadd, 2004
12 Line Dancing Jenkins, 2007, by Comanche Acres
12 Noble Roman Blyth, 1993/94
11 Color Focus Jenkins, 1990
8 Countess Zeppelin Hager, 1987
8 Midnight Rival Johnsen, 1993
8 Out of Dreams Cadd, 2004
